Are you an experienced individual with passion, energy, enthusiasm and a knack for creating a warm and welcoming environment for our people and customers? We are looking for a bookstore assistant manager with creativity, innovation, a commitment to customer service at the highest level and extensive book knowledge. Flexibility and excellent organisational skills are also essential.

Key Responsibilities

  • Take responsibility to run a store like their own.
  • Lead, play and support the Store Manager, Booksellers and other colleagues while having fun together.
  • Build relationships with Customers, Suppliers and Authors.
  • Drive performance so that the team can achieve the monthly sales budget and receive incentives.
  • Oversee day‑to‑day operations of the store.
  • Monitor inventory and security controls.
  • Monitor daily and weekly sales to ensure monthly sales target is achieved.
  • Monitor the quality of customer service throughout the store.
  • Supervise, guide and support team members.
  • Assist in training and growing our people for internal promotion.
  • Maximise sales and profits while minimising controllable expenses.
  • Maintain a commitment to a strong community presence.
  • Oversee bookstore events.
  • Work on the sales floor, requiring physical activity.
  • Prepared to work retail hours.

Qualifications

  • A minimum of matric with at least 1–3 years of experience within sales or retail.
  • Minimum of 1–3 years of managing staff preferably within a sales or retail environment.
  • A diploma or degree would be advantageous.
  • Strong analytical skills, and ability to use industry and competitor knowledge to consistently identify opportunities to drive sales.
  • Experience with POS, inventory management & merchandising in a fast‑paced, rewards/performance‑driven organisation.

Benefits

  • A personal (own) use Book Discount
  • Incentivised targets
  • Group Retirement Annuity
  • Medical Insurance
  • Employee Birthday Voucher and Day Off
